Hi Gent. If you double-click on RAAF_Expansion_A.exe I suspect that you will find that it will install itself. You can do this with the file anywhere on your PC, it doesn't need to be in the CFS2\Aircraft folder. Follow the simple instructions as for installing any other program & go fly those missions.

As for the others, go back & read the installation tute again.* http://www.simviation.com/acinstall.htm
Make sure you understand the basic principles which are the same for all M$ sims. You have to extract the downloaded zipfiles before installing them. If you're new at this you might find the tips on my Lair useful. Click on the link to Grumpy's Lair from my sig below.

*PS. Ignore part 4 as this does not apply to CFS2. WinXP has its own onboard unzipper so you don't need WinZip.
